Answer: a) AA
Step-by-step explanation:
Given: In right triangle JKL, m∠K = 44°.
In right triangle PQR, m∠Q = 44°=m∠K .
Since both the given triangles are right angle triangle.
Therefore, there must be one angle in both the triangles ΔJKL and ΔPQR have measures as 90°.
Therefore, by AA similarity criteria we can say that ΔJKL ≈ ΔPQR .
- AA similarity postulate says that if any two angles of a triangle equals to the two angles of another triangle, then both the triangles are similar.
